Midlands-based healthtech firm Rem3dy Health has secured a £500,000 SAFE investment from Future Planet Capital Regional through the West Midlands Co-Investment Fund, as part of a broader £9 million raise. Other investors include the Japanese beverage and wellness group Suntory, US-based nutrition and agriculture company ADM, and French pharmaceutical company UPSA.
The new funds are intended to expand manufacturing capacity, increase production, and strengthen Rem3dy Health’s presence in key markets such as the US and Asia.

3D Printing Powers Personalised Nutrition
Consumers are increasingly seeking alternatives to traditional vitamins, which often involve multiple pills, synthetic additives, and plastic packaging. Rem3dy Health addresses this demand through its brand Nourished, which uses patented 3D printing technology to create customised, seven-layer nutrient gummies. These “stacks” use food-derived ingredients without artificial additives.
To date, Rem3dy Health has raised £19 million, established three factories, and secured 29 approved patents, while developing new manufacturing technologies to expand its product range.

Developments in 3D Printed Health
Rem3dy Health’s investment reflects a broader shift in how 3D printing is being applied across the health sector — from nutrition to pharmaceuticals. The same technology that enables personalized nutrient stacks is also driving innovations in drug manufacturing.
In August, Private, nonprofit science and technology organization Battelle and 3D pharmaceutical company Aprecia received a U.S. Defense Advanced Research Projects Agency (DARPA) agreement to advance the Establishing Qualification Processes for Agile Pharmaceutical Manufacturing (EQUIP-A-Pharma) research program, funded by the U.S. Department of Health and Human Services (HHS) Administration for Strategic Preparedness and Response (ASPR) Office of Industrial Base Management and Supply Chain (IBMSC). The EQUIP-A-Pharma program will explore how Battelle’s custom small-scale chemical synthesis platform, combined with Aprecia’s Z-Form Flex 3D printing technology, can accelerate U.S. drug production to provide high-quality, sustainable medications.
Elsewhere, Chinese drug 3D printing firm Triastek recently announced that its 3D printed drug product, D23, Budesonide Ileum Targeted Tablets for the treatment of IgAN (Immunoglobulin A Nephropathy)—a kidney disorder characterized by the buildup of immunoglobulin A (IgA) deposits in the kidneys—has demonstrated favorable results in a recent clinical study. D23 is a budesonide delayed-release tablet produced using the Melt Extrusion Deposition (MED) process, which Triastek has scaled through its proprietary 3D Microstructure for Intestine Targeting (3DμS-IT) platform. This platform facilitates the precise release and delivery of the drug to the ileum, enhancing the tablet’s effectiveness.
